## Configuration

Twigreaper, our stale-branch cleanup bot, reads everything from a single env file — no CLI flags, no hidden defaults. For your security review: it only deletes branches older than PRUNE_DAYS and never touches protected ones. Dry-run is on unless DRY_RUN=false. It also needs repo access, granted by the credential set on the next line of the env file.

secret setting of yagef-baweg: RELAY_SECRET29=cb53deb59a49ed54d9f43599b54ca

**Q: Why do my map tiles look out of date after I push style changes?**

The Marletow tile renderer sits behind a cache layer called Frostbin, and it holds tiles for up to six hours. Pushing a new style doesn't purge it automatically — you have to kick off a manual invalidation for the affected zoom levels. Don't flush everything; that hammers the render farm. Step-by-step purge instructions are on the internal page below.

operations page: https://jenkins.zemvarcloud.local/job/merge_requests/repo/build/73930b4b30f0a8ed

## Runbook: Spreadsheet export memory

The Ledgerfoil export worker builds the full workbook in memory before streaming, so large exports (over ~200k rows) can push the pod toward its limit and trigger OOM kills. Symptoms: exports stuck in "preparing," followed by worker restarts in the logs.

First response: lower the row-batch size and re-queue the job rather than raising the memory limit — raising it just delays the failure. The relevant configuration values are shown below.

deployment values, yadug-bawif:
[framir]
team = pelox
access_code = ac_a38ab2
owner = tamion.julael
host = framir.tolvaqlabs.test
port = 11211
peer = tammir.zemvargrid.local
salt = 2215ef03
pin = 1541

**Vendor note: Inkmill markdown pipeline**

Rendering for Parchway docs is outsourced to Inkmill under an annual contract, renewing each March. They handle sanitization and PDF export; we own the upload queue. SLA: 4-hour response on rendering failures. Escalate only after two failed retries. Their support desk is reachable at the address below.

billing contact of hahaf-baguf = zorael.tammir.jorius@sivrelhq.internal